Waikato River search continues for missing swimmer after water tragedies

by Rachel Morgan News Editor January 10, 2026
written by Rachel Morgan News Editor

Tragedy struck across several regions of New Zealand today, with multiple water-related incidents resulting in at least two deaths and one person in serious condition. The incidents occurred in Canterbury, Bay of Plenty, Waikato, Mahurangi East, north of Auckland, and Tasman.

Rising Temperatures and Increased Risk

Authorities responded to a death at Akaroa on Banks Peninsula after being notified at approximately 1:15 PM. A short time later, at 2:55 PM, emergency services were called to a location off Poripori Rd in the Bay of Plenty, where another person was pulled from the water and pronounced dead at the scene. CPR was administered, but was unsuccessful. Police have confirmed that both deaths will be referred to the coroner.

Did You Know? The incidents occurred as heat warnings were in effect across parts of New Zealand, with temperatures reaching the 30s Celsius and drawing large numbers of people to beaches and rivers.

In a separate incident, a person remains in serious condition after being pulled from the water in the Tasman district. Details surrounding this incident remain limited.

Water Safety Concerns

Glen Scanlon, chief executive of Water Safety New Zealand, urged caution, noting that deceptively calm conditions can quickly become dangerous. He advised against swimming or diving alone in any New Zealand water environment. Scanlon emphasized the importance of swimming between the flags at patrolled beaches and utilizing the expertise of surf lifesavers.

Expert Insight: These incidents underscore the inherent risks associated with water activities, even when conditions appear favorable. The combination of warmer temperatures and increased participation in water-based recreation creates a heightened need for vigilance and adherence to safety guidelines.

Scanlon also stressed the importance of wearing lifejackets while fishing, whether from land or a boat, and maintaining close supervision of children near water.

The Rise of Privacy-Enhancing Technologies (PETs)

We’re seeing a surge in the development and adoption of Privacy-Enhancing Technologies. These aren’t just theoretical concepts anymore; they’re practical tools being deployed by forward-thinking organizations. Homomorphic encryption, for example, allows computations to be performed on encrypted data without decrypting it first. This means businesses can gain valuable insights without ever accessing sensitive information in plain text. Differential privacy adds statistical noise to datasets, protecting individual identities while still enabling accurate analysis.

The Decentralized Privacy Movement & Blockchain

Blockchain technology, initially known for cryptocurrencies, is finding new applications in data privacy. Decentralized identity solutions, built on blockchain, give individuals control over their own data, allowing them to selectively share information with businesses without relying on centralized intermediaries. This approach reduces the risk of data breaches and empowers users.

Solid, a project led by Tim Berners-Lee (the inventor of the World Wide Web), is a prime example. It aims to give individuals “data pods” where they can store and control their personal information. While still in its early stages, Solid represents a potentially revolutionary shift in how data is managed online.

Worker missing after trench collapse in Kansas City, Kansas

by Chief Editor July 25, 2025
written by Chief Editor

Tragedy in Kansas City: Worker Dies in Trench Collapse – What Can Be Done to Prevent Future Accidents?

A somber scene unfolded in Kansas City, Kansas, as a search and rescue operation turned into a recovery after a trench collapsed at a fiber optic installation site near 16th Street and Metropolitan Avenue. The worker, who was last seen operating an excavator, was found deceased after an extensive search that lasted for hours. The incident, which occurred around 2:15 p.m., prompted a large-scale response from local fire crews and OSHA officials. The trench, measuring 16 to 18 feet wide and 25 feet deep, presented significant challenges for rescue efforts, especially given the heavy rainfall that exacerbated the site’s instability.

The Immediate Aftermath and Ongoing Investigation

The focus now shifts to understanding the circumstances that led to this tragic event. OSHA (Occupational Safety and Health Administration) is conducting a thorough investigation to determine whether safety protocols were followed and if weather conditions played a contributing role. The presence of trench shields, brought in to prevent further collapses, suggests awareness of the potential hazards involved in trench work. However, questions remain about whether these measures were sufficient and properly implemented.

Did you know? Trench collapses are rarely survivable. According to OSHA, a cubic yard of soil can weigh as much as a car.

DuckDuckGo now lets you hide AI-generated images in search results

by Chief Editor July 18, 2025
written by Chief Editor

DuckDuckGo’s AI Image Filter: A Glimpse into the Future of Search

The internet is evolving at warp speed, and one of the biggest shifts we’re seeing is the rise of AI-generated content. DuckDuckGo’s recent move to let users filter AI images in search results isn’t just a feature update; it’s a harbinger of where search engines are heading. This proactive stance against AI “slop,” as some are calling it, signals a growing user preference for authentic, human-created content.

The Problem: AI’s Impact on Image Search

The sheer volume of AI-generated images is becoming overwhelming. Finding genuine images amongst the AI-created ones can be difficult. Remember that Google controversy mentioned in the original article? It’s a real concern. Users are increasingly frustrated by search results dominated by AI-generated content, especially when looking for specific, real-world visuals.

Did you know? According to a recent study, the presence of AI-generated content in image searches has increased by over 300% in the last year alone. This surge underscores the urgency of solutions like DuckDuckGo’s filter.

How DuckDuckGo Is Tackling the AI Image Issue

DuckDuckGo’s approach involves a blend of manual curation and open-source blocklists. Utilizing resources like the “nuclear” list from uBlockOrigin and uBlacklist Huge AI Blocklist allows for a robust initial defense. While no filter is perfect, the goal is to significantly reduce the number of AI-generated images surfacing in search results. Users can easily access the new setting through the “Images” tab and select to show or hide AI content.

Mount St. Helens & Beyond: Are Reckless Rescues Changing the Wilderness Experience?

The majestic beauty of places like Mt. St. Helens often draws adventurers seeking thrills and a connection with nature. But a concerning trend is emerging: a rise in risky behavior leading to costly and often dangerous search-and-rescue operations. This has sparked a debate about accountability and the future of wilderness accessibility. Is it time to rethink how we approach safety and financial responsibility in the great outdoors?

The Growing Strain on Rescue Teams

Recent incidents around Mt. St. Helens, as reported in the Los Angeles Times, highlight the issue. From kayakers taking on waterfalls to hikers unprepared for challenging conditions, the number of wilderness rescues is climbing. This puts an enormous strain on volunteer teams and local resources. Skamania County, Washington, home to Mt. St. Helens, is even considering ordinances to hold negligent individuals accountable.

Did you know? Search-and-rescue operations in U.S. national parks numbered over 3,300 in 2023. This covers a broad spectrum, from lost children to injured climbers. Consider the Joshua Tree National Park, where harsh desert conditions add to the difficulties of the missions.

The Cost of Adventure: Should Rescues Come with a Bill?

The idea of charging individuals for rescues is not new. New Hampshire offers “Hike Safe Cards,” which fund search and rescue. In 2013, California considered recouping costs after a costly search for two lost hikers, which the authorities could not obtain at the time. The law has since been revised to allow for reimbursement under specific circumstances.

Pro Tip: Before embarking on any outdoor adventure, research the conditions, pack appropriate gear, and inform someone of your plans. Consider carrying a personal locator beacon (PLB) or satellite messenger for emergency communication. See the NH Fish and Game Department for essential tips to prepare your adventures.

The Counterarguments: Impact on Safety and Trust

Charging for rescue services is not universally supported. The Mountain Rescue Association and the Colorado Search and Rescue Association express concerns that such policies may deter people from calling for help, potentially worsening dangerous situations. They emphasize the volunteer nature of rescue teams and the importance of ensuring that individuals feel comfortable seeking assistance without fear of financial penalties.

The Price Comparison Wars: Google’s Antitrust Battles and the Future of Online Shopping

The online price comparison market is a battleground, and Google is at the center of a long-running antitrust saga. This case, highlighted by legal action from companies like Acheter Moins Cher (AMC), reveals fundamental shifts in how we shop online. Understanding the current landscape and the evolving regulatory environment is crucial for consumers and businesses alike. This is an area to watch; the ramifications could change the way you find the best deals.

The Core of the Complaint: Google’s Search Practices

At the heart of the matter lies Google’s dominance in the online search arena. Companies like AMC accuse Google of unfairly promoting its own price comparison service, Google Shopping, by manipulating search results. The claim is that Google strategically demoted competitors while prominently featuring its own service, effectively stifling competition.

Did you know? The European Commission has levied significant fines against Google for these practices. These penalties underscore the severity of the alleged antitrust violations.

The Impact on Consumers and Competition

The consequences of these practices are far-reaching. Reduced competition can lead to fewer choices and potentially higher prices for consumers. When one entity controls the visibility of information, it can shape the market and limit consumer access to a range of options. The lawsuit underscores the importance of a level playing field for smaller businesses to compete.

As the market stands today, many former price comparison services have disappeared. The result is a market that, according to critics, is no longer focused on the consumer. They argue that the primary goal of several remaining services is not providing the best deals, but directing traffic to affiliated retailers.

Legal Battles and Regulatory Scrutiny: The Role of the DMA

The legal battles continue. The courts have already confirmed some of the accusations against Google, but further determinations are still underway. The European Union’s Digital Markets Act (DMA) is now adding another layer to the scrutiny. The DMA seeks to regulate large online platforms (like Google) and prevent anti-competitive behavior.

Google’s AI-Powered Audio Summaries: The Future of Search is Listening

Remember sifting through endless search results, eyes blurring from the screen? Those days are rapidly fading. Google is pioneering a new era of search with its AI-driven audio summaries, offering a hands-free, more engaging way to consume information. This technology, initially available through Google’s Google Labs, is poised to reshape how we interact with the digital world. Get ready to listen up!

Beyond Text: Why Audio Summaries Matter

The beauty of these audio summaries lies in their accessibility. Imagine listening to a concise overview of complex topics while multitasking – commuting, exercising, or even cooking. This is particularly beneficial for in-depth topics, not just quick facts. Instead of simply finding out when Father’s Day is, you could delve into the historical roots of the holiday via an engaging, conversational podcast-style audio.

The AI pulls information from top search results and compiles it into an easy-to-digest audio clip, presented with two distinct voices that mimic a podcast format. You can even adjust the playback speed, and see the sources from which the AI generated the information, letting you dive deeper into a specific area, or follow any link that caught your attention.

Did you know? Voice search queries are on the rise. According to a report by PwC, 71% of consumers prefer voice search over typing, especially for complex tasks.

The Evolution of Audio Overviews: Where It Started and Where It’s Headed

Google’s not new to the audio game. This functionality was first tested in their NotebookLM tool. The evolution has led to increased interactivity. Now, users can ask questions in real-time, further enhancing the conversational experience. The “Deep Dive” feature enables users to focus the AI on specific aspects of the chosen topic.
